CWU fashion students make dresses for girls in need

  • May 2, 2014

The Central Washington University Student Fashion Association is collecting pillowcases for "Dress a Girl Around the World," a program where students will take the pillowcases and turn them into dresses for girls in need.

The Student Fashion Association will accept donated pillowcases through May 9. Students will have a table from 10:00 a.m. until 1:30 p.m. on weekdays at the SURC at CWU, and also will accept pillowcases at Jerrol's, Relics and Michaelsen Hall.
